I'm stealing this from the animal crossing community forum.  i was looking for some info on Wendell's patterns.  I didn't realise there were so many:



A. Pattern Name: Money
Feed Wendell: Dorado, Goldfish or Popeyed Goldfish

B. Pattern Name: Field of Flowers
Feed Wendell: Angelfish, Guppy, or Neon Tetra

C. Pattern Name: Grass
Feed Wendell: Black Bass

D. Pattern Name: Water Puddle
Feed Wendell: Frog or killifish

E. Pattern Name: Street Corner 1
Feed Wendell: Cherry Salmon or Dace

F. Pattern Name: Street Corner 2
Feed Wendell: Bluegill or Char

G. Pattern Name: Street Corner 3
Feed Wendell: Rainbow Trout or Sweetfish

H. Pattern Name: Street Corner 4
Feed Wendell: Pale Chub or Yellow Perch

I. Pattern Name: Vertical Path
Feed Wendell: Barbel Steed

J. Pattern Name: Horizontal Path
Feed Wendell: Carp

K. Pattern Name: Intersection
Feed Wendell: Bitterling or Pond Smelt

L. Pattern Name: Ground
Feed Wendell: Crucian Carp



M. Pattern Name: Stone Paving
Feed Wendell: Pike

N. Pattern Name: Manhole Cover
Feed Wendell: Giant Snakehead

O. Pattern Name: Pitfall
Feed Wendell: Arowana

P. Pattern Name: Footstep
Feed Wendell: Koi

Q. Pattern Name: Horizontal Track
Feed Wendell: Sea Bass

R. Pattern Name: Vertical Track
Feed Wendell: Butterfly Fish or Surgeonfish

S. Pattern Name: Curved Track 1
Feed Wendell: Dab or Olive Flounder

T. Pattern Name: Curved Track 2
Feed Wendell: Octopus or Squid

U. Pattern Name: Curved Track 3
Feed Wendell: Barred Knifejaw or Red Snapper

V. Pattern Name: Curved Track 4
Feed Wendell: Clownfish or Seahorse

W. Pattern Name: ! Sign
Feed Wendell: Zebra Turkeyfish

X. Pattern Name: Chocolate
Feed Wendell: Chocolate Heart



1. Pattern Name: Treasure Chest
Feed Wendell: King Salmon or Ray

2. Pattern Name: Stairs
Feed Wendell: Football Fish

3. Pattern Name: Red Carpet
Feed Wendell: Lobster or Salmon

4. Pattern Name: Pitfall Warning
Feed Wendell: Moray

5. Pattern Name: Coloring House
Feed Wendell: Coconut

6. Pattern Name: Self Portrait
Feed Wendell: Birthday Cake

7. Pattern Name: Coloring Boy
Feed Wendell: Blue Candy or Yellow Candy

8. Pattern Name: Coloring Girl
Feed Wendell: Green Candy or Red Candy

9. Pattern Name: Coloring Rover
Feed Wendell: Peach

10. Pattern Name: Coloring Resetti
Feed Wendell: Cherry

11. Pattern Name: Coloring Pelly
Feed Wendell: Orange

12. Pattern Name: Coloring Nook
Feed Wendell: Apple



13. Pattern Name: Mystery Circle A
Feed Wendell: Freshwater Goby

14. Pattern Name: Mystery Circle B
Feed Wendell: Loach

15. Pattern Name: Mystery Circle C
Feed Wendell: Catfish

16. Pattern Name: Mystery Circle D
Feed Wendell: Eel

17. Pattern Name: Picture Frame
Feed Wendell: Rare Mushroom

18. Pattern Name: Memo
Feed Wendell: Elegant Mushroom or Flat Mushroom or Round Mushroom or Skinny Mushroom

19. Pattern Name: Gyroid
Feed Wendell: Gar

20. Pattern Name: Rhino Beetle
Feed Wendell: Crawfish

21. Pattern Name: Iron Floor
Feed Wendell: Tuna or Blue Marlin

22. Pattern Name: ? Block
Feed Wendell: Red Turnip

23. Pattern Name: Cracked Ground
Feed Wendell: Piranha

24. Pattern Name: Forbidden Sign
Feed Wendell: Pufferfish



25. Pattern Name: Outer Space
Feed Wendell: Jellyfish or Sea Butterfly

26. Pattern Name: Brick
Feed WEndell: White Turnip
